Facts About Computer SecurITy

As an application of information securITy, computer securITy handles issues regarding information privacy rights and IT is a branch of computer science. Restrictions are reinforced by new platforms and encryptions every day. The system was first used by milITary commanders, but now IT's manly used by people that make online transactions or at a lower level for any other information, like e-mail address or personal documents from their computer. The biggest advancements in encryption are used in the milITary codes.

In large terms, computer securITy is protection against intentional and unauthorized destruction or modification of data and against access to data by unauthorized persons. There are three areas regarding computer securITy: confidentialITy, integrITy and authentication. ConfidentialITy is ensuring that data can't be accessed by unauthorized persons, integrITy means that data can't be altered by unauthorized users wIThout IT being detected by authorized users and authentication is the process of ensuring that each user is who he claims to be.

There are some terms that are often used in computer securITy. Access control is the process that sets privileges to each user, some being able to access more information that other. AvailabilITy is a property of the system; IT means that IT has to be operational and functional at any time, and privacy ensures that personal information about each user can't be used for any other purposes than the ones stated. A secure system must accomplish all of these requirements about privacy, securITy and confidentialITy, for users and information.

A normal personal computer usually has a firewall that assures the computer securITy. IT has ways to prevent unauthorized access and destruction of data. The last resort for computer securITy is recovery. IT can consist of backup disks, media or other methods to back up important data and after the intruder has left, you can at least restore some of the information. Each computer must be analyzed and there are a lot of methods to do this. The system can be protected in many ways, but the most important part is to realize that each PC has weak points. If you know the vulnerabilITies of the system, you know how to protect IT. There are different areas involved in a good computer securITy plan. New viruses appear every day and IT is almost impossible to detect threats that appear after the release of the anti-virus program. In this case, the best method is to stay in touch wITh new anti-virus updates and download them as soon as possible.

A computer securITy manager should be careful about the three major parts of the securITy and mostly about privacy. If personal data is leaked, valuable information can be lost and used against you. Any computer crime is prevented wITh the help of computer securITy.

Complete computer securITy is impossible to realize, the recommended option is "layered securITy". WITh multiple ways of securITy, the chances of the system to be broken are smaller. There are many possible layers, like firewall, anti-virus or online scans. All of them are preventing viruses, but each in a different way. This increases the chances of detecting any virus.
